Position Overview :

Tap Healthcare is seeking a highly skilled and compassionate Heart Failure ICU Nurse Practitioner to join our critical care team in Houston, Texas. This full-time, night shift role is dedicated to providing specialized care for patients with advanced heart failure in a fast-paced ICU environment. At Tap Healthcare, our advanced practice providers are recognized for their expertise, collaboration, and commitment to delivering exceptional outcomes for some of our most complex patients.

Required Qualifications :

AGACNP Adult Geriatric Acute Care Nurse Practitioner.

Current State of Texas license to practice professional nursing.

Certification by one of the following :

American Nurse Credentialing Center (ANCC)

National Certification Center in area of specialty

American Association of Nurse Practitioners (AANP)

American Certification of Critical Care Nurses (AACN) Acute Care Nurse Practitioner Certification

Certified in Basic Life Support (BLS) and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S).

Minimum of 2 years of clinical nursing experience (RN or NP) in Cardiology, Cardiac Care, or Cardiovascular Nursing.

Preferred Qualifications (Nice to Have) :

Experience working with heart failure populations.

Prior Acute Care Nurse Practitioner experience.

ICU experience as a Cardiovascular or Heart Failure RN.

Work Schedule : Full-time, Night Shift Only
